Subject: [PATCH v2 49/50] image: Split up boot_get_fdt()
Date: Thu,  6 May 2021 08:24:37 -0600	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210506142438.1310977-22-sjg@chromium.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210506142438.1310977-1-sjg@chromium.org>

This function is far too long. Before trying to remove #ifdefs, split out
the code that deals with selecting the FDT into a separate function.

Signed-off-by: Simon Glass <sjg@chromium.org>
---

(no changes since v1)

 common/image-fdt.c | 227 +++++++++++++++++++++++++--------------------
 1 file changed, 127 insertions(+), 100 deletions(-)
